If You Have 1-3 Days in Chongqing
You can focus on Chongqing's city exploration.
1-Day Ultimate Itinerary for Chongqing
If your time is limited, we recommend staying in the Jiefangbei area (city center).
- Morning: Shancheng Alley
- Afternoon: Liziba Light Rail through the building → Yangtze River Cableway → Kuixinglou
- Evening: Hongya Cave Night View Hot Pot → Walk to Jiefangbei Pedestrian Street
In just one day, you can explore Chongqing's hillside old streets, iconic cyberpunk 8D landmarks, and also enjoy authentic local food.
Shancheng Alley is a downhill route. Along the way, you can stop by Ling'er Jie Snack Shop for a short rest and try local treats like shredded chicken tofu pudding and ice jelly.
A hot pot dinner is a perfect way to relax your legs. You can simply sit back and enjoy the cyberpunk night views of Hongya Cave and Jiefangbei across the river.
2-Day Chongqing Itinerary with Classic City Highlights
Plan 1 day for Jiefangbei area. On another day, arrange a half-day for Ciqikou, and another half-day for the Nanbin Road area across from Jiefangbei.
- Day 1: Kuixinglou, Three Gorges Museum, Liziba, Eling Elevated Walkway, Hongya Cave
- Day 2: Ciqikou Ancient Town & 1949 Theater, Yangtze River Cableway, Longmenhao & Xiahaoli
We'll take you to explore old Chongqing and the dock culture in Ciqikou Ancient Town. Here, you'll also try local traditional snacks like fried dough twists and strange-tasting broad beans.
Yangtze River Cableway will take you directly to Longmenhao from Jiefangbei.
It's best to visit in late afternoon, Longmenhao for daytime views (4-5 pm), and Xiahaoli for night scenery (7-8 pm).
These two old streets are connected, and you can find many boutique restaurants there for dinner while enjoying the Yangtze River view or the retro vibe of the old buildings.

3-Day Chongqing in-Depth Tour
This itinerary goes beyond tourist spots and takes you deeper into the city's local neighborhoods and everyday life, giving you a more immersive way to explore Chongqing.
Each evening, we arrange one iconic Chongqing night view, Hongya Cave, Xiahaoli, and the Two Rivers Confluence. A bonus is that if any of the three days fall on a Saturday, you'll catch the drone shows.
Day 1: cyberpunk 8D
Kuixinglou → Shancheng Alley → Eling Park → Liziba → Jiefangbei→Hongya Cave
Day 2: underground world and history
Bomb shelters tour → Three Gorges Museum → Xiahaoli
Chongqing has more than 1,600 air-raid shelters, and many of these wartime sites have now been transformed into everyday spaces filled with local life.
You can buy fruits from farmers in the market, enjoy a hot pot, and take 8 escalators to descend to the 116-meter-deep subway station, experiencing Chongqing's 8D underground.
Day 3: old Chongqing vibe and authentic food
Ciqikou Ancient Town→Local Neighbourhood Food Tour→Yangtze River Cableway to Nanbin Road→ the confluence of two rivers night view on rooftop bar or restaurants.
In Jiefangbei residential streets, you'll taste real daily Chongqing food like Chongqing noodles, old-style baked rolls, and tofu pudding. They can be non-spicy.
The way you enjoy food here is very "Chongqing" too. Use a red plastic stool as your table, or even eat casually on the steps of an overpass alongside locals.

If You Have 4-6 Days in Chongqing
You can cover the city highlights and extend to surrounding attractions, like Wulong Karst (1-2 days), Yangtze River Cruise (3-4 days), Dazu Rock Carvings (1 day), and Wujiang Gallery (1 day).
5-Day Chongqing and Yangtze River Cruise
This itinerary is best for a full Three Gorges experience.
- Day 1: Chongqing arrival
- Day 2: Three Gorges Museum, panoramic viewpoint of Chongqing at Nanshan Mountain, board your ship in the late afternoon
- Day 3-4: Yangtze River Cruise
- Day 5: arrive in Yichang, visit Three Gorges Dam, Yichang departure
At Three Gorges Museum, you'll learn about the origins of the Three Gorges, how people lived with the Yangtze River, and depended on boats for daily life.
The whole journey is relaxing with minimal walking. You can reach Nanshan directly by car. While on the cruise, simply sit on the deck or your private balcony to enjoy the scenery. Shore excursions are also well-supported with cable cars or ferry transfers.

6-Day Chongqing, Wulong, and Wujiang Gallery
This all-in-one itinerary lets you experience Chongqing's cyberpunk 8D cityscape, dramatic mountain landscapes, and a peaceful river cruise journey.
- Day 1: Chongqing arrival
- Day 2: Shancheng Alley, hot pot in bomb shelter, Eling Park, Liziba, Kuixinglou, Jiefangbei, Hongya Cave
- Day 3: Wulong, visit Three Natural Bridges and Longshuixia Gorge
- Day 4: Wulong, visit Fairy Mountain and Furong Cave
- Day 5: Wujiang Galley boat ride, Gongtan Ancient Town
- Day 6: departure
During your 2-day trip in Wulong, you'll discover four distinct karst landscapes, from sky holes and gorges with waterfalls to vast grasslands and the stalactite cave.
Three Natural Bridges and Longshuixia Gorge are usually arranged on the same day since they are close to each other. However, both involve more walking. If you prefer a slower travel pace, visit Three Natural Bridges and Fairy Mountain with laid-back grassland first.
Wujiang Gallery is about a 2-hour drive from Wulong. Compared to a 3–4 day Yangtze River cruise, you can enjoy a similar river-and-mountain landscape here in just half a day, with fewer crowds and a much quieter atmosphere.
